About Intel Core i5-4430S

Yo, the Intel Core i5-4430S is a quad-core Haswell chip from 2013 that still holds up for basic tasks with its 2.70 GHz base clock boosting to 3.20 GHz turbo. Rocking 4 threads, 6MB L3 cache, and a chill 65W TDP on 22nm process, it fits perfectly in Socket 1150 boards. In real-world use, expect smooth multitasking like web browsing, Office apps, and light photo editing without breaking a sweat. Cinebench R23 multicore scores 3,709 points, while Geekbench multicore hits 2,773, proving it's solid for everyday productivity. Single-core Geekbench at 980 and Cinebench R23 at 523 mean quick app launches but not for heavy single-threaded loads. If you're upgrading an old rig, this i5-4430S delivers reliable performance without modern power hunger. Snag an i5-4430S for upgrades that punch above weight. Compatibility is straightforward for the i5-4430S plug into LGA 1150 motherboards like H81 or B85 chipsets, but check BIOS for Haswell support. Z87/Z97 boards unlock overclocks if unlocked, though this locked chip sticks to stock speeds. RAM tops at DDR3-1600, so max 32GB dual-channel for best perf. Coolers are easy with stock Intel ones handling 65W fine, no exotic needs. Avoid mixing with Skylake stick to 4th gen for stability.
